What companies run services between Apach, France and Basel, Switzerland?

Luxembourg Railways (CFL) operates a train from Thionville to Mulhouse Ville twice daily. Tickets cost CHF 60–100 and the journey takes 2h 11m. TGV inOui also services this route twice a week.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Luxembourg, P+R Bouillon to Basel Euroairport FR 6 times a week. Tickets cost CHF 21–50 and the journey takes 4h 45m. BlaBlaCar Bus also services this route 4 times a week.
